Meals-on-Wheels - Hillsboro Senior Center needs drivers. Volunteers use their own vehicles to deliver 7 to 10 noon-time meals to private homes in the Hillsboro - Aloha area. Each route takes approximately 1 1/2 hours to complete. Contact the center at 503-648-3823.

Cross Walk |
Residents of Good Shepherd group homes or others with special
developmental needs have the opportunity on the 4th Sunday of each month
to enjoy an evening of singing, making crafts, Bible study and just
spending time together. Volunteers plan and lead these
get-togethers, and anyone interested in lending a hand is always welcome. For more information Contact Carolyn Meier or Sherryl Boitz. |

Quilters |
The Quilters make and provide quilts for a variety of
charitable organizations which have included Lutheran World Relief,
Salvation Army, and Bethlehem's Mexico Mission Trip. Quilts have
also been provided for fund raising events within the church. The Quilters meet at 9:30 a.m. on Mondays year round. Participation if open to all quilters and quilter-wanna-bees. For more information contact Lorna Zimbrick. |

Rebekah Mission Society |
Also known as LWML ( Lutheran Women's Missionary League) or
Women's Guild, this group is open to all women of Bethlehem Lutheran
Church and meets at 11:30 a.m., on the 3rd Thursday of each month from
September through June. Their purpose is to affirm our relationship
with the Triune God and use our gifts in ministry to all people. For more information contact: Lorraine Sturm |

Manna Ministry |
This caring ministry serves families and individuals
experiencing a disruption in family life by providing meals during the time
of need such as hospitalization, extended illness or injury, or other
significant family changes. Volunteers prepare meals that can be
delivered hot or frozen for use at a future date. If you would like
to volunteer to make and/or deliver meals, or if you or someone you know
has a need please contact Jennifer Headrick. |
